如何在Windows中升级PHP版本?

时间:2019-05-01 01:47:14

标签: php windows wamp

我正在使用WAMP服务器(Windows中为x64),最近通过从Wamp Server Files下载和安装文件来升级我的PHP版本。

我配置了apache并为所需的扩展名更改了php.ini文件,并且效果很好。

当我转到localhost-> phpinfo(在WAMP服务器中)时,它显示为7.3.4的版本,这意味着PHP升级正在服务器上进行。

但是,当我在CMD上运行php -v时,我得到的版本是7.0.10(我的先前版本)。

我尝试了这些东西

  • WAMP服务器托盘图标(右键单击)->更改PHP CLI版本-> 7.3.4
  • 将PHP 7.3.4路径添加到PATH变量(C:\wamp64\bin\php\php7.3.4

但是,它仍然不起作用。

然后,我在CMD中尝试了where php

它给了我这个结果。

C:\wamp64\bin\php\php7.0.10\php.exe
C:\wamp64\bin\php\php7.3.4\php.exe

在PATH变量中,添加了C:\wamp64\bin\php\php7.3.4\php.exe。但是,没有C:\wamp64\bin\php\php7.0.10\php.exe。它来自哪里?

如果我可以删除它,我想我可以解决问题。

或者我可以通过其他方法解决问题吗?

1 个答案:

答案 0 :(得分:0)

我终于找到了解决问题的方法。

在Windows中,有两个路径变量。

  1. 用户PATH变量
  2. 系统PATH变量

PHP 7.0.10变量位于用户PATH变量中。删除它可以解决问题。